Output 6eea20a7b395db2e5e4b49a5152d07cd76b42bc66309343667a6b4312572218d:0

value
587529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bddf9a62697c84216dd873913f2768bed1649e1 OP_EQUAL
address
3JpNCXGjFTJqB6iKCqRmrnnRE5E5w8NNtj
transaction
6eea20a7b395db2e5e4b49a5152d07cd76b42bc66309343667a6b4312572218d
spent
true